The PECB ISO 9001 Lead Auditor training course enables you to develop the necessary competence to perform quality management system (QMS) audits by applying widely recognized audit principles, procedures, and techniques. This training course combines the requirements of ISO/IEC 17021-1, the recommendations of ISO 19011, and other good practices of auditing and integrates them into a comprehensive methodology which enables you to successfully plan, conduct, and close ISO 9001 conformity assessment audits.
Apart from a theoretical basis, the training course also provides examples, exercises, and quizzes to help you practice the most important aspects of conformity assessment audits: interpretation of ISO 9001 requirements in the context of an audit, principles of auditing, application of audit methods, approaches to evidence collection and verification, leading an audit team, drafting nonconformity reports, and preparing the final audit report. The successful completion of the training course is followed by an exam. If you successfully pass the exam, you can apply for the “PECB Certified ISO 9001 Lead Auditor” credential. An IAS accredited and internationally recognized “PECB ISO 9001 Lead Auditor” certificate validates your professional capabilities and demonstrates that you have the knowledge and skills to audit a QMS based on ISO 9001.

The course begins with an overview of the course objectives and structure, followed by an introduction to standards and relevant regulatory frameworks. The certification process is explained to clarify expectations.
Participants explore the fundamental concepts and principles of quality management and gain a structured understanding of a Quality Management System (QMS) in accordance with ISO 9001.
Day two focuses on fundamental audit concepts and principles. Participants learn about audit approaches based on evidence and risk.
The initiation of the audit process is explored, including planning activities and conducting a Stage 1 audit.
Preparation for the Stage 2 on-site audit is examined to ensure readiness for practical audit execution.
This day is dedicated to Stage 2 audit activities. Participants learn how to conduct on-site audit procedures, manage communication during the audit and ensure professional interaction with auditees.
The session covers audit procedures, creating audit test plans and drafting audit findings and nonconformity reports in a clear and structured manner.
Participants learn how to document audit results and conduct quality reviews of audit findings.
The formal closing of the audit is addressed, including presenting findings and evaluating action plans proposed by the auditee.
The session also explores activities beyond the initial audit, including surveillance audits and continual evaluation.
Managing an internal audit programme is covered, along with competence requirements and professional evaluation of auditors.
The training concludes with a structured closing session.
The final day is dedicated to exam preparation and completion of the official certification examination in accordance with certification body requirements.

Results will be communicated by email in a period of 6 to 8 weeks, after taking the exam. The results will not include the exact grade of the candidate, only a mention of pass or fail.
Candidates who successfully complete the examination will be able to apply for a certified scheme which is explained in the course description.
In the case of a failure, the results will be accompanied with the list of domains in which the candidate had failed to provide guidance for exams’ retake preparation.
Candidates, who disagree with the exam results, may file a complaint by writing to examination@pecb.com or through PECB ticketing system.
There is no limit on the number of times a candidate may retake an exam. However, there are some limitations in terms of allowed time-frame in between exam retakes, such as:
After the fourth attempt, a waiting period of 12 months from the last session date is required, in order for candidate to sit again for the same exam. Regular fee applies.
For the candidates that fail the exam in the 2nd retake, PECB recommends to attend an official training in order to be better prepared for the exam.
